If the dog has red bloodshot eyes, this may be a sign of inflammation or infection. In some cases, environmental exposures such as allergens, smoke dust or other irritants can cause your pet’s eyes to become red and inflamed. Sometimes abnormally long eyelashes can also rub against your dog’s cornea, causing redness, inflammation and pus in the eye.
